Isaiah 58
Serving in our world as Christ served in His
Is this not the fast which I chose, to loosen the bonds of wickedness, to undo the bands of the yoke, and to let the oppressed go free, and break every yoke? Is it not to divide your bread with the hungry and bring the homeless poor into the house; when you see the naked, to cover him; and not to hide yourself from your own flesh? Then your light will break out like the dawn, and your recovery will speedily spring forth; and your righteousness will go before you; the glory of the Lord will be your rear guard.
Isaiah 58:6-8
“Isaiah 58” is a thrilling group of ministries designed to reach out to those in need, first within our church family, and then to the wider community in Phoenix. The goal of “Isaiah 58” is to show the glory of God to the world as the church obediently radiates His goodness in word and deed, resulting in the in-gathering of the lost, the maturing of the church, and the reviving of the cosmos.
Opportunities in “Isaiah 58” include the following:
Angel Tree: Christmas presents to children of prisoners
Benevolent Fund: material assistance to those in need in our body
Blood Mobile: provides a way for us to save lives in the community by donating blood
GriefShare: caring for those who have lost a loved one (see: www.cbcaz.org/links)
Meals for Crisis Pregnancies: meals for those in the midst of difficult pregnancies
Meals for Moms: meals for families welcoming a new baby
MealMakers: meals for families during crisis events
Neighborhood Ministries: serving alongside a church in a disadvantaged part of the city
Osborn Health and Rehab: worship services and love at a local nursing home
Wheels From Above: renovating wheelchairs for those who otherwise could not afford one
Widowed Ministry: serving those in our body who have lost their spouse
